How they compare

Morocco currently reports 179.88 billion current US$ against 133.81 billion current US$ in Kenya, a difference of 46.07 billion current US$.

That makes Morocco's figure about 1.3 times Kenya's.

Across all 66 years both countries report, Morocco has been ahead every year.

Globally, Kenya ranks 62nd and Morocco ranks 59th of 209 countries.

Gross national income is the total income earned by all residents within an economic territory during an accounting period. It is equal to gross domestic product plus earned income receivable from abroad minus earned income payable abroad. This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This indicator is expressed in United States dollars.
